Claims (15)
- 上側ジョー部および下側ジョー部を有するエンドエフェクタと:
器具シャフトと;
前記エンドエフェクタを前記器具シャフトに移動可能に接続する手首部アセンブリであって、前記手首部アセンブリは、前記器具シャフトに対して直交する2つの軸周りに前記器具シャフトに対して前記エンドエフェクタを関節運動させるように動作可能であり、前記手首部アセンブリは、内部通路を有する内部シースを有し、前記内部シースは、前記手首部アセンブリの動きとともに曲がるように可撓性であるが、軸方向には動かない、手首部アセンブリと;
前記上側ジョー部および前記下側ジョー部内で並進するように配置されているビーム部材であって、前記上側ジョー部に移動可能に結合するための第1の部分および前記下側ジョー部に移動可能に結合するための第2の部分を有し、前記第1の部分は前記上側ジョー部のレール機構内でスライドするように構成され、前記第2の部分は前記下側ジョー部のレール機構内でスライドするように構成される、ビーム部材と;
押圧アセンブリおよび引張アセンブリを有する作動アセンブリであって、前記引張アセンブリは、引張力を前記ビーム部材に伝達するように構成され、前記押圧アセンブリは、圧縮力を前記ビーム部材に伝達するように構成され、前記引張アセンブリおよび前記押圧アセンブリは、前記引張アセンブリを介して引張力をおよび前記押圧アセンブリを介して圧縮力を伝達することによって、前記ビーム部材に遠位および近位の運動を提供するように相補的な方法で動作し、前記作動アセンブリは前記内部通路を通って延び、前記作動アセンブリは、前記内部シースに対する前記作動アセンブリの移動の間に、前記内部シース内で軸方向にスライドする、作動アセンブリと;
を有する、
手術装置。 - 前記引張アセンブリは、細長いケーブルを有し、
前記押圧アセンブリは、前記細長いケーブルを囲む内腔を有する、
請求項1に記載の手術装置。 - 前記押圧アセンブリは、密巻ばねを有する、
請求項1に記載の手術装置。 - 前記密巻ばねは、円筒形の外面を有する、又は、境界を接する凸面および凹面を有する、又は、螺旋状に切断されたチューブを含む、
請求項3に記載の手術装置。 - 前記押圧アセンブリは、凹部のパターンを有するチューブを有する、
請求項1に記載の手術装置。 - 前記押圧アセンブリは、張力下で分離する複数の押圧要素を有する、
請求項1に記載の手術装置。 - 前記押圧アセンブリは、複数の球形部材を有し、
前記引張アセンブリは、前記球形部材を収容する内腔を画定する、
請求項6に記載の手術装置。 - 前記球形部材は、可撓性ロッドによって連結される、
請求項7に記載の手術装置。 - 前記押圧アセンブリは、複数の別々の要素であって、前記別々の要素間の横方向の相対的滑りを一方向に制限する境界面を有する、複数の別々の要素を有する、
請求項1に記載の手術装置。 - 前記押圧アセンブリは、複数の別々の要素であって、前記別々の要素間の相対的なねじれを防止する境界面を有する、複数の別々の要素を有する、
請求項1に記載の手術装置。 - 前記押圧アセンブリは、平ワッシャの積み重ねを有する、
請求項1に記載の手術装置。 - 前記押圧アセンブリは、円環ディスクの積み重ねを有する、
請求項1に記載の手術装置。 - 前記引張アセンブリは、複数の板金バンドを有し、
前記押圧アセンブリは、前記複数の板金バンドがそれを通って延在する管腔を画定する矩形ワッシャの積み重ねを有する、
請求項1に記載の手術装置。 - 前記押圧アセンブリは、可撓性ロッドの一次元アレイを有し、
前記引張アセンブリは、前記可撓性ロッドの一次元アレイを有し、
前記可撓性ロッドの一次元アレイは、前記引張力を前記ビーム部材に伝達し、
前記可撓性ロッドの一次元アレイは、前記圧縮力を前記ビーム部材に伝達する、
請求項1に記載の手術装置。 - 前記押圧アセンブリは、ニッケル-チタンロッドを有し、
前記引張アセンブリは、前記ニッケル-チタンロッドを有し、
前記ニッケル-チタンロッドは、前記引張力を前記ビーム部材に伝達し、
前記ニッケル-チタンロッドは、前記圧縮力を前記ビーム部材に伝達する、
請求項1に記載の手術装置。
